Typical Project Cost by Bathtub Type
Adjusted for Philadelphia, PA (+2%)Same default project size (default scope), priced across each material tier.
| Tier | Material rate | Total project | Installed per unit |
|---|---|---|---|
| Standard alcove | $299 | $1,772 | $0 |
| Freestanding acrylic | $798 | $2,271 | $0 |
| Freestanding cast iron | $1,496 | $2,969 | $0 |
| Drop-in soaking | $1,196 | $2,669 | $0 |
| Jetted / whirlpool | $1,994 | $3,467 | $0 |
Material rates reflect the latest BLS construction PPI adjustment. Installed totals include labor and supplies but exclude permits and any tear-out beyond the calculator's default scope.

Local Labor Rates Near Philadelphia, PA
State-level mean hourly wages from BLS OEWS, May 2023.
| Trade | SOC | Mean hourly (PA) | vs national | Loaded billing rate |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Plumbers & PipefittersMost relevant | 47-2152 | $33.40 | +1.7% | ~$80/hr |
| Electricians | 47-2111 | $33.95 | +5.4% | ~$81/hr |
| HVAC Mechanics | 49-9021 | $28.20 | -1.6% | ~$68/hr |
| Carpenters | 47-2031 | $28.65 | -1.1% | ~$69/hr |
| Painters | 47-2141 | $25.10 | +1.3% | ~$60/hr |
| Roofers | 47-2181 | $24.78 | -4.3% | ~$59/hr |
| Construction Laborers | 47-2061 | $27.41 | +20.3% | ~$66/hr |
"Mean hourly" is the BLS OEWS state-level cross-industry mean wage paid to the worker. Loaded billing rate is a typical 2.4× multiple used in residential bids to cover overhead, insurance, taxes, vehicle, and contractor margin. Use it as a sanity check on a quoted hourly rate.

Low / Mid / High Project Scenarios
Low Scenario
$1,774Standard alcove tub replacement in the same footprint with reconnection only.
Mid Scenario
$3,824Freestanding acrylic tub with acrylic surround, valve update, and standard removal.
High Scenario
$8,903Jetted tub in new location with tile surround and niche, full rough-in, and cast iron removal.
What Changes the Estimate Most in Philadelphia?
- Tub type and material create the widest price difference between a basic alcove unit and a freestanding soaking tub.
- Plumbing relocation, structural reinforcement, and tile surround work are the main reasons bathtub labor exceeds a simple drop-in swap.
- Whirlpool jets, inline heaters, and custom tile or stone surrounds are the extras that most often expand a bathtub-installation estimate.
When This Calculator Is Less Accurate
This calculator is less accurate when the project includes structural floor reinforcement, plumbing relocation, whirlpool electrical work, or custom tile surround installation beyond a standard bathtub swap.
Use the result as a budgeting starting point, then validate with local contractor quotes if the scope includes specialty materials, hidden damage, or permit-driven design changes.
How Much Does Bathtub Installation Cost in Philadelphia?
Bathtub installs commonly range about $1,500-7,000 depending on whether you are swapping the same footprint, moving plumbing, retiling walls, and the tub style you choose.
Cost Factors:
- Freestanding, cast iron, and jetted tubs cost more for the unit and often need stronger floors, access, or electrical for pumps
- New locations or tub-to-shower conversions multiply labor because of drain relocation, waterproofing, and framing
- Tile surrounds with niches add materials and skilled labor compared with acrylic systems or leaving existing walls
- Updating valves and drains is typical on older homes; full rough-in applies when supply and waste paths change significantly
- Cast iron tear-out and haul-away is heavier work than standard acrylic removal and shows up as a separate line on many bids

What should I verify with contractors in Philadelphia?
Confirm permits, HOA or historic-district rules, material lead times, and whether demolition or hidden damage is included. Pennsylvania codes and local inspection steps can change both price and schedule compared with national averages.
How much does bathtub installation cost?
Many projects fall near $1,500-7,000. A simple alcove swap with minimal plumbing stays lower; new layouts, premium tubs, and full tile surrounds move toward the top of that band or beyond.
Is labor included in the tub price from a big-box store?
Rarely as one number you can rely on. This calculator separates the tub unit, materials like surround and plumbing parts, and installation labor so you can match how contractors actually bid.
Do I need a permit to replace a bathtub?
It depends on your jurisdiction and scope. Moving drains or altering wet walls often triggers permits; like-for-like swaps sometimes do not. When in doubt, ask your local building department.
